Static Properties

The get/set property methods in both ComLib.ReflectionHelper and ComLib.Reflection.ReflectionUtils throw an exception if the "obj" parameter is null. Static properties do not require an instance of...

Id #8716 | Release: None | Updated: May 2, 2013 at 3:53 PM by richarddeeming | Created: May 2, 2013 at 3:53 PM by richarddeeming

Logging LogFile filepath cannot contain directory and rollover

When a LogFile is created with the filepath containing more than a filename, the rollover check fails. For example, creating this LogFile: Logger.Default.Append(new LogFile("kishores_log", "C:\kis...

Id #8713 | Release: None | Updated: Apr 30, 2013 at 6:26 PM by remco305 | Created: Apr 30, 2013 at 6:26 PM by remco305

Logging file rollover bug

When the log file is set to roll over and the initial log grows larger than the _maxFileSizeInMegs value, each subsequent message is written to an individual file with -partX in the filename. It en...

Id #8711 | Release: None | Updated: Apr 30, 2013 at 6:17 PM by remco305 | Created: Apr 30, 2013 at 6:17 PM by remco305

Cannot get ComLib using directive to work

I am evaluating the CommonLibrary 0.9.0.2 I have created a simple console app targetting .NET4.0, added a reference to the CommonLibrary.dll (after unblocking and unzipping the binary download). ...

Id #8446 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by zedhex | Created: Dec 7, 2012 at 10:39 AM by zedhex

RepositorySql should not append "s" to entity table names

In RepositorySql Init you make the assumption that the database model and the entity models will always use different forms of the noun by implicitly adding an "s" to the entity name.   e.g the ent...

Id #8286 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by PatrikM | Created: Sep 18, 2012 at 2:39 PM by PatrikM

Ini document, trailing spaces in the property names are part of the key

If you read the following ini file into an IniDocument:   [globalSettings] key1 : value key2 : another value   The space between the name "key1" and the colon (:) will be part of the key that is st...

Id #8238 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by RemkoJansen | Created: Aug 31, 2012 at 7:41 AM by RemkoJansen

Ini documents with comments are not read correctly

When reading ini documents that contains comment lines (a line starting with a semi colon) the parser doesn't handle the cr+lf characters at the end of the line correctly.   The result is that the ...

Id #8221 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by RemkoJansen | Created: Aug 28, 2012 at 7:25 AM by RemkoJansen

CSV parser incorrect behaviour on contiguous separator characters ending the last file line

csv with header: name, date, eventname, eventtimes line: 'a',20120715 23:34:32,, this line should get parsed into a 4 token list, instead the parser puts it into a 3 token list this causes an unex...

Id #8149 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by RemkoJansen | Created: Aug 1, 2012 at 9:57 AM by Totnetnaz

Special characters aren't parsed in CSV

I am using the CSV object to parse a CSV file and I noticed special characters such as "Ö" and "Ð" weren't being properly parsed.   So I added in Encoding.Default to the parameter list in File.Rea...

Id #8132 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by barda4 | Created: Jul 25, 2012 at 6:21 PM by barda4

UrlSeoUtils.BuildValidUrl keeps accented characters

If using accents (éëÄÖ) in the name and parsing it with the BuildValidUrl method, these are kept in result. These should be converted to their representative characters.

Id #8037 | Release: None | Updated: Feb 22, 2013 at 12:03 AM by devosoft | Created: Jun 11, 2012 at 1:43 PM by devosoft